William Edwin Jones pushes daughter Renee Andrewnetta Jones (8 months old) during protest march on Main St. in Memphis Tennessee.

Photograph by:
Dr. Ernest C. Withers, American, 1922 - 2007  Search this
Subject of:
William Edwin Jones, American  Search this
Dr. Renee Jones Jeffrey, American, born 1961  Search this
Medium:
silver and photographic gelatin on photographic paper
Dimensions:
H x W (Sheet): 19 7/8 × 15 15/16 in. (50.5 × 40.5 cm)
H x W (Image): 14 5/8 × 14 15/16 in. (37.1 × 37.9 cm)
Type:
gelatin silver prints
Place depicted:
Memphis, Shelby County, Tennessee, United States, North and Central America
Date:
August 1961
